titleOfInvention Determination of organism substance producing ammonia as reaction product
abstract PURPOSE: To determine directly an organism substance producing ammonia as a reaction product, exisiting in a specimen containing ammonia, by using a combination of specific enzymatic reaction systems. n CONSTITUTION: (i) Glutamic dehydrogenase (GlDH), α-ketoglutaric acid (α- KG), reductive nicotinamide adenine dinucleotide (NADH), and an enzyme and substrate [e.g., isocitric dehydrogenase (iCDH), and isocitric acid] to reduce nicotinamide adenine dinuleotide (NAD + ) are added to a specimen, all NH 3 existing in a mixed solution is consumed, and simultaneously, formed NAD + is converted into NADH. (ii) Reductive nicotinamide adenine dinucletode phosphate (NADPH) and an enzyme (e.g., urease in case of urea determination) to form NH 3 as a reaction product are added to the mixed solution to carry out the reaction, and the reduction in amount of NADPH is measured to determine an organism substance (e.g., urea) producing NH 3 as a reaction product. n COPYRIGHT: (C)1984,JPO&Japio
